Movenpick Hotel Hanoi
Whatever your reason for visiting Hanoi, Movenpick Hotel Hanoi is the perfect venue for an exhilarating and exciting break away. The true local flavors and culture of Hanoi are yours with a stay at Movenpick Hotel Hanoi, located just 1.2 km from the famous Old Quarter.
Travelers are guaranteed to have a hassle-free stay with all the amenities and services provided by Movenpick Hotel Hanoi. Stay connected throughout your stay with free internet access provided. To help pre-arrange your arrival and departure, airport transfer services can be booked before you even check in. Your explorations of Hanoi can be assisted with taxi, car hire and shuttle services available.
Parking is provided free of charge for guests. You'll have no problem planning out your days and transportation needs with front desk services including concierge service, express check-in or check-out, luggage storage and safety deposit boxes. The hotel's ticket service and tours can even help you book tickets and reservations for entertainment and explorations. Wear your favorite outfits again and again thanks to the laundromat, dry cleaning service and laundry service offered at Movenpick Hotel Hanoi.
In-room conveniences such as 24-hour room service, room service and daily housekeeping will make staying in a great choice. You can also get small travel items and sundries at the convenience stores without having to leave the Movenpick Hotel Hanoi. The hotel is entirely non-smoking. Smoking may only take place in restricted designated areas.
Rooms at Movenpick Hotel Hanoi are designed with the guest in mind. To enhance your stay, some rooms at the hotel come with linen service, blackout curtains and air conditioning. Some rooms have cable TV to keep guests entertained. You may be assured to know that a refrigerator, a coffee or tea maker, bottled water, instant coffee, instant tea and mini bar are available in some select rooms.
You can stay fresh and clean with a hair dryer, toiletries, bathrobes and towels provided in some of the guest bathrooms. The executive lounge is an extra bonus for guests, providing an exceptionally comfortable and well-appointed atmosphere for lounging.

I almost didn’t choose this hotel because there were a few bad reviews. I can’t imagine what problem someone had to cause them to write anything negative about the Movenpick. As a Marriott titanium member I stay at Marriotts, but the one in Hanoi was distant from the old quarter and the French quarter so I stayed at the Movenpick. The old city is about a 10 walk away. Service was fantastic. The room was impeccably clean and has everything that I needed. Water pressure in the shower was great. The only minor problem I encountered was communication. Some staff spoke little English so a couple of times someone was called over to answer my questions. I have no reservations about staying in the Movenpick if I visit Hanoi again.

I stayed at the King Suite for three nights on a business trip for work. The service is impeccable. Cleanliness is top notch and there were 0 issues on my trip there. Requests for taxi's were super easy. They were always at the outside hotel lobby. Just a few but not crowded with them which is nice. Porters and customer service is extremely courteous and polite. Breakfast buffet is absolutely delicious with various tastes to cater to a wide crowd. Of course, in Vietnam, the fruits are a must since they are always fresh, ripe and organic. I have never come across better fruits even coming from a next door neighboring tropical country where fruits are abundant. Their croissants are fantastic too! Overall I would highly recommend this place for a return visit stay.

Check in and out was seamless. The staff was friendly and helpful. The bed was very comfortable. The design of the room was attractive with a large desk to work at and a wing back chair. The hotel is in easy walking distance to the old district of the city. The foreign exchange rate at the hotel was better than at the airport & close to the rates found on the Internet. I would stay again if I have the opportunity to visit Hanoi in the future.

Great location. minutes walk to the expo area. However, around 15 minutes walk to old quarter - places of interest and eateries. Great for singles and couples alike. It will be advisable for tourist with younger children to stay in old quarters for convenience. Counter staff are polite and attentive, and this applies to the restaurant staff. Only 1 bad encounter 1) Taxi guaranteed by hotel seems to take advantage by going longer route(issue solved after providing feedback). ==> My advice, engage grab taxi.
